Fiona, an artist, loves to travel to new places, try new foods, and wear flashy clothes. according to the big five model, her do

minant personality trait is:
Social Studies
1 answer:
Archy [21]3 years ago
3 0

The correct answer is openness

Openness refers to the appreciation of adventure, unfamiliar ideas and a variety of experience. It involves a preference for unusual ideas and a preference for a variety of ideas as opposed to routine like is the case for Fiona

Describe the steps Washington took to set up the government of the new republic
Lunna [17]

George Washington was the first president the United States had. In order to build the Federal government of the new republic, president George Washington had to take two steps:

  1. He decided to set up a Federal court.
  2. He made the cabinet where four trusted advisors (Thomas Jefferson, Alexander Hamilton, Edmund Randolph and Henry Knox) would help and advise him.
